Handover Note — Master Key Set, Gate Building

To the incoming shift lead: the full set of master keys for the Gate Building is in the sealed pouch inside the shift-lead drawer, counted at twelve keys. A courier from Strathen Facilities collects them tomorrow at 09:00 for the re-keying job. Do not break the seal before collection. The courier must follow the hand-over instruction given below.

drop instructions, yafog-yawip: the quenmir olidor courier leaves the julox tamion keliel ledger at gate 5283 under passcode 336825

## Environments: ledgerline-api

Three environments: dev, staging, prod. Each has its own connection pool sizing for the Postgres cluster; prod pools are deliberately smaller per pod to stay under the cluster's global cap. Reviewers: any change to pool size or idle timeout needs sign-off, since the last bump exhausted prod connections in minutes. Current prod pool settings are below.

config for bagep-kageg:
ULADOR_LOG_LEVEL=warn
ULADOR_METRICS_HOST=metrics.ulador.tolvaqcorp.corp
ULADOR_POOL_SIZE=32

## Runbook: SQL lint (Osprey Data Platform)

All SQL files under /warehouse must pass the linter before merge; CI blocks otherwise. Rules: uppercase keywords, no SELECT *, explicit JOIN conditions, max line length 120, trailing semicolons required. Run the linter locally before pushing — CI is slow and you'll wait twenty minutes to find out about a missing semicolon. Rule overrides go in the repo-level config, never inline comments. Suppressions need a ticket reference. The linter currently runs with this configuration.

settings of fafog-haduf:
ZORIX_PIN=4648
ZORIX_METRICS_HOST=metrics.zorix.paliqsys.corp
ZORIX_LOG_LEVEL=info
ZORIX_TENANT=druix

Audit item 14: Tile-rendering cache layer (Quiltmap). Verify TTLs match the published policy, eviction under memory pressure is LRU as documented, and stale tiles are never served past 24h. Check that cache keys include zoom level and style version — prior incident stemmed from missing style version. Confirm metrics for hit ratio and eviction rate are exported and alarmed. Note any deviation in the findings sheet. All discrepancies must be acknowledged in writing by the engineer of record, named below.

account owner for fajep-yagef: Kasix Eliiel